What is Two-Factor Authentication?

Two-factor authentication adds a second layer of security to your account login process. Typically, this involves something you know (your password) and something you have (a phone or a security key). This method ensures that even if someone has your password, they still need a second factor to access your account.

Step-by-Step Guide to Enable 2FA on YouTube

  1. Sign Into Your Google Account
    • Start by signing into your Google Account linked to your YouTube channel. You can do this by visiting the Google homepage and clicking on the sign-in button at the top right corner.
  2. Access Security Settings
    • Once logged in, navigate to your Google account settings by clicking on your profile picture and selecting “Manage your Google Account.” Then, go to the “Security” tab on the left-hand navigation panel.
  3. Setting Up Two-Step Verification
    • Scroll down to the “Signing in to Google” section and click on “2-Step Verification.” Google will then guide you through the setup process.
  4. Choose Your Second Factor
    • You have several options for your second authentication factor:
      • Text message or voice call: Google will send a code to your phone, which you must enter to log in.
      • Google Authenticator app: Generates a code you enter at login, which refreshes every few seconds.
      • Security key: A physical device that you connect to your computer or bring near your phone to verify your identity.
  5. Follow the Prompts
    • Follow the on-screen instructions to choose your preferred method and set it up. If you opt for the Google Authenticator app, for instance, you’ll need to scan a QR code with the app to link it to your account.
  6. Backup Options
    • Set up backup options to ensure you can access your account if you lose your primary two-factor method. These might include backup codes, an alternative phone number, or a backup email.
  7. Confirm and Activate
    • Once you have set up your preferred method and backups, Google will ask you to confirm your choices. After confirming, 2FA will be active on your account.

Tips for Managing 2FA on YouTube

  • Keep Backup Codes Safe: Store your backup codes in a secure location. These codes can be crucial if you lose access to your primary 2FA method.
  • Regularly Update Your Recovery Info: Ensure your recovery phone number and email address are up-to-date to prevent lockouts.
  • Educate Your Team: If you work with a team on your YouTube channel, educate them about the importance of 2FA and secure practices.
